How to Make Crispy Fresh Lettuce Wrapped Veggie Spring Rolls with Almond Dip
- Prepare the veggies: Using a mandoline slicer or sharp knife, thinly slice the carrots, cucumber, and bell pepper. Chop the green onions. Set aside.
- Make the almond dip: In a food processor, combine almonds, soy sauce, sesame oil, garlic, ginger, and sriracha (if using). Blend until smooth, adding water as needed to reach your desired consistency.
- Assemble the spring rolls: Pat the romaine lettuce leaves dry. Place a small amount of the veggie mixture in the center of each leaf. Roll tightly, tucking in the sides as you go. Secure with toothpicks if needed.
- Cook the spring rolls: In a large skillet, heat oil over medium heat. Add the spring rolls and cook until golden and crispy, about 2-3 minutes per side. Drain on a paper towel-lined plate.
- Serve: Serve the crispy fresh lettuce wrapped veggie spring rolls hot with the almond dip on the side. Garnish with sesame seeds and chopped peanuts if desired.
Cook's Tips for Perfect Crispy Fresh Lettuce Wrapped Veggie Spring Rolls with Almond Dip
- Pro tip: Pat the lettuce leaves dry to prevent soggy spring rolls.
- Common mistake and fix: Don't overfill the lettuce wraps. This can make them difficult to roll and can lead to soggy spring rolls. If this happens, try using smaller lettuce leaves or less filling.
- Pro tip: For a healthier version, you can air-fry the spring rolls instead of frying them in oil.
- Pro tip: Make the almond dip ahead of time and store it in the fridge for up to a week.
Storing & Reheating Crispy Fresh Lettuce Wrapped Veggie Spring Rolls with Almond Dip
Short-Term Storage
Store in an airtight container in the fridge. Store leftover spring rolls in the fridge for up to 3 days. Reheat in the oven at 350°F (180°C) for 5-7 minutes. Make-ahead tip: You can make the almond dip up to a week ahead of time. The veggies can be prepped up to a day ahead of time.
Freezing Crispy Fresh Lettuce Wrapped Veggie Spring Rolls with Almond Dip
Freeze uncooked spring rolls for up to 2 months. Cook from frozen, adding a few minutes to the cooking time.
How to Reheat Without Drying It Out
Oven: Reheat cooked spring rolls in the oven at 350°F (180°C) for 5-7 minutes. Microwave: Reheat cooked spring rolls in the microwave for 1-2 minutes, but this may make them soggy.
